WebApr 2, 2024 · A bone bruise, or contusion, is an injury to your bone that is not a fracture. A bone bruise happens when the bone gets several small cracks. Blood and fluid collect just under the cracks. Ligaments or cartilage near the bone bruise are also commonly damaged. WebMay 11, 2024 · Signs and symptoms of a bone bruise include: Pain and tenderness in the affected area. Swelling in the tissues around the impacted location. Change in color on the surface of the skin. Joint pain near the affected area. Swelling of the joints around the bone. Extreme pain or pain that is more severe than a typical bruise.

WebMar 26, 2024 · The metatarsal bones are some of the most commonly broken (fractured) bones in the foot. There are five metatarsal bones in each foot. They are the long slim bones which run the length of the foot to the base of the toes. For more information on foot anatomy, see the separate leaflet called Heel and Foot Pain (Plantar Fasciitis).
